Job Description

Key Responsibilities

  • Modelling of field instruments such as flow pressure temperature level and F&G equipment. For the same interpret P&IDs (Piping & Instrumentation Diagrams) and ensure design consistency.
  • Modelling of cableways e.g. cable tray ducts conduits.
  • Work closely with process electrical piping and instrument engineers to integrate instrumentation into plant design.
  • Ensure all designs comply with applicable codes and standards.
  • Conduct 3D model reviews with clients.
  • Prepare material take-offs (MTOs) for procurement and construction
  • Prepare instrumentation design deliverables including:
    • Instrument location layouts - field
    • Fire & Gas (F&G) equipment location layouts - field
    • Instrument rack room/ control room layouts
    • Hook-up drawings
    • Cable routing layouts
    • Installation typical process hook-ups
  • Support construction teams with technical clarifications and field modifications.

Software skills

Proficiency in following software as minimum:

  • Intergraph S3D
  • Model review software Smart Review
  • AutoCAD/ BricksCAD
